Since our humble beginnings in 2006, Danish Design has broadened its collection significantly and today we are proud to bring the finest Danish and Scandinavian furniture from past and present to Singapore.

Danish Design Co represents authentic designer furniture from iconic designers by the likes of Hans Wegner, Finn Juhl and Borge Mogensen. Our curated collection from Scandinavia’s premier design houses embodies exceptional quality, considered design and time-honoured craftsmanship by skilled hands.

With the right care, our timeless furniture is made to last generations. Nothing is less ecological than a product with a short shelf life. We take our environmental responsibilities seriously and only choose to work with suppliers who is certified in accordance to strict international environmental standards. This include the elimination of toxic chemicals and carcinogens in our furniture, use of leather from animals that have been raised under strict ethical guidelines, use of FSC-certified wood to name but a few.

This company’s service delivery is so incredibly bad it’s unbelievable.

After seeing my review in facebook which they have since hidden, I received a call from their service staff who tried to do service recovery. But she could not even get the basic facts right. She told me my Gubi stools are one week late as the end of 16 weeks from my order is 20 Jan (ordered on 25 Sep) and I’ll be getting my delivery on week of 23 Jan. I told her to please go count again as that is incorrect. Week 16 is 13 Jan, not 20 Jan. The service staff continued to argue that she is correct for the next 5 mins even after going to get a calendar to count. Finally, she managed to count properly and told me yes, I am absolutely right and the order is 2 weeks late.

And regarding my other order of the Montana bedside unit, she said it was ordered on 17 Oct and they will stick to the 16 week deadline. And mentioned that they will try to expedite it to before CNY. I have an email (in addition to a phone call) that shows that the sales associate mentioned they have placed the order (email dated 11 Oct). I called from overseas at that time to inform that to please place the order and I will come by to pay the rest of the money on 17 Oct. The email confirmed that was done. So once again, end of week 16 is week of 23 Jan. And getting my order that week is as per the contract and not that they are doing me a favor by expediting anything at all.
And they offer me a $80 voucher. I don’t need the voucher because no way am I buying anything from them ever again.
